OG phonics and spelling

This week we reviewed the Soldier rule. We completed a word sort with different ways to spell the /k/ sound at the end of words.
Eg) -k, book
       k-e, like (silent e)
       -ck, luck (soldier rule: long spelling right after short vowel)
